BIOMONITORING OF AIR POLLUTION BY CORRELATING THE POLLUTION TOLERANCE INDEX OF SOME COMMONLY GROWN TREES OF AN URBAN AREA

P.M. MASHITHA AND V.L. PISE

Abstract

Selected plants from Nagpur city were analysed for the Air Pollution Tolerance Index (APT!) to moniter the level of air pollution. Around 50% of the plants were found be sensitive to (10% being be highly sensitive). The plants which were able to tolerate the pollution were very few namely Halo ptelea spp. and Cassia spp. as indicated by there high APTI index.
